Michigan court rules Trump can remain on GOP primary ballot
A Michigan appeals court ruled Thursday that former President Donald Trump's name can appear on the state's Republican primary ballot, following a challenge that sought to remove him over his role in the Jan. 6, 2021, attack on the U.S. Capitol.
The court's decision follows similar ones in Minnesota and Colorado that ruled Trump is allowed to remain on the ballot because primaries are a party-run elections. However, the Michigan ruling held open the possibility that Trump's inclusion on a general election ballot could still be challenged.
Olympian, WWII Hero Louis Zamperini Dies At 97
Louis Zamperini, an Olympic runner who later survived the brutality of a Japanese prisoner-of-war camp after his bomber crashed in the Pacific, has died at age 97. Zamperini's life story was chronicled in the best-seller Unbroken, and a film based on the book is set to be released in December.
In a statement, his family said that Zamperini had "recently faced the greatest challenge of his life with a life-threatening case of pneumonia.

Wallace Shawn Movies and TV Shows
Wallace Shawn is an American actor, playwright, essayist, and screenwriter. Born on November 12, 1943, he has made a notable impact in the film industry with memorable roles in movies such as My Dinner with Andre (1981), The Princess Bride (1987), and Clueless (1995). He is also recognized for voicing the character Rex in the Toy Story franchise since 1995. Shawn's impressive filmography includes The Bostonians (1984), Prick Up Your Ears (1987), Vanya on 42nd Street (1994), The Double (2013), Maggie's Plan (2015), and Marriage Story (2019).
Don't Starve Together Switch version release date announced
Recommended VideosDon’t Starve Together, the multiplayer expansion to Don’t Starve from the talented developers over at Klei, is coming to the Nintendo Switch on April 12, 2022. The news came today via Klei’s Twitter account after it was announced in the December 2021 Indie World showcase that the game was coming to the Switch platform.
Another feature announced is that there will now be shared unlocks between participating platforms (Xbox, PC, & Switch but not PlayStation).
Capitol Lens | The Eyes of History
Posted February 20, 2024 at 3:28pm Roll Call photojournalist Bill Clark is among the winners in the 2024 White House News Photographers Association’s “Eyes of History” contest. His photo, from Feb. 2, 2023, showing then-Speaker Kevin McCarthy gesturing during a news conference in the Capitol’s Statuary Hall, won first place in the “On Capitol Hill” category.
